69 multi-storey residential buildings undergo major renovation in Astana
04.03.2025 01:13:52 341
In Astana, 69 multi-storey residential buildings were overhauled under the state program for 2022-2024, the official website of the capital's akimat reports.
In addition, elevators in 55 buildings were repaired or replaced during this period.
"Major repairs of common property are divided into two types - minimal and maximum types of work. The minimum type of work includes the repair of the roof, entrance and basement of the residential building with the installation of an automated system for regulating heat consumption and general meters of heat energy in the house, as well as the creation of an accessible environment for people with limited mobility, taking into account the technical capabilities of the building.
The maximum type of work is the repair of the roof, entrance, basement, facade, repair (replacement) of elevator equipment with the mandatory installation of an automated system for regulating heat consumption and general heat meters in the house, installation/re-equipment of general engineering networks and fire safety systems of residential buildings, as well as the creation of an accessible environment, taking into account the technical capabilities of the building, - said Gulvira Abetova, Deputy Director of Orken Kala LLP.
The decision to participate in the overhaul of the common property of the condominium facility, the repair (replacement) of elevators at the expense of a state budget loan must be made by the owners of apartments and non-residential premises in an apartment building at a general meeting.
Then the fact of participation in the program not only, but also the amount of costs imposed on each apartment, non-residential premises should be approved. It is determined depending on the size of the areas of all residential and non-residential premises.
In addition, at the general meeting, the owners of apartments and non-residential premises must determine the period for the return of budget funds. According to the rules, it can be from 7 to 15 years. There is also an estimate of costs, service providers and responsible persons when accepting work, including hidden types of work.
“Major repairs are ongoing in Astana. Residents can apply by contacting Orken Kala LLP, which is the operator of this program,” Abetova noted.
It should be noted that since 2011, a state program for the major repair of residential buildings has been operating in Astana at the expense of local budget funds. Any multi-storey building in need of repairs can apply for a budget loan for this purpose.
